Quality Engineer
DEPARTMENT: Manufacturing / LOCATION: Amesbury, MA
REPORTS TO: OperationsSupport Manager / FLSA STATUS: Exempt
POSITION PURPOSE:
  • Key liaison between Production and the Management team to support the Sealing Division’s quality system, fulfill customer PPAP and APQP requirements, collect and monitor data, identify areas for improvement and implement corrective/preventive actions. This hands-on position also plays a key role in trouble-shooting product and manufacturing quality issues utilizing root cause analysis techniques and statistical analysis.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Create and implement changes to support the site’s Quality Management System, and ensure full compliance to ISO 9001.
  • Lead the design and analysis of inspection and testing processes, mechanisms and equipment; conducts quality assurance tests; and performs statistical analysis to assess the cost of and determine responsibility for, products or materials that do not meet required standards and specifications.
  • Champion corrective and preventive actions and control of Nonconforming Product.
  • Interface with CI Manager in support of customers to resolve quality issues, driving permanent and effective corrective/preventative actions.
  • Partner with New Product Development to establish up-front measurements and test procedures prior to production runs.
  • Develop and implement a traceability program to manage product quality with near real-time corrective actions and reduce the cost of non-conformance

KNOWLEDGE / SKILLS / ABILITIES:
  • Knowledge of and demonstrated proficiencyin quality concepts such as Lean/Six Sigma, 6S, and ISO 9001, APQP, PPAP and FMEA. Must be able to demonstrate the application and appropriate use of statistical methods and tools such as Gauge R&R, Statistical Process Control, Capability analyses etc.
  • Results driven, strategic thinkerwith the ability to solve problems and communicate at all levels of the organization.
  • Demonstrated ability and willingness to work “hands-on” with manufacturing team members in leading continuous improvement projects and activities
  • Ability to comprehend computer generated reports, design specifications and engineering drawings
  • Ability to write clearly and create detailed reports
  • Ability to handle multiple tasks smoothly with a high level of accountability

QUALIFICATIONS / PRIOR EXPERIENCE:
  • This position requires a 2-4 year degree in a technical discipline, along with 3 to 5 years’ experience in Quality in a manufacturing environment (injection molding and/or extrusion experience preferred).
  • Lean manufacturing experience required, green belt preferred
  • Certified Quality Engineer (CQE) is a plus.
  • Knowledge of full Microsoft Office Suite required.

WORK ENVIRONMENT/OTHER REQUIREMENTS:
  • Must be able to use normal office equipment (scanner, printer, copier, computer, phone, fax)
  • Must be able to talk/hear/sit/stand/walk for prolonged periods of time
  • The work performed is conducted in a facility with noise levels where hearing protection is required for extended periods of time.
  • Must be able to periodically travel domestically
  • Ability to lift up to 25-50 lbs on an occasional basis
